Safety Data, Analysis, and Evaluation
TRB’s Transportation Research Record: Journal of the Transportation Research Board, No. 1953 explores real-time traffic factors associated with sideswipe crashes on highways; a new approach for analyzing traffic accidents at hazardous road locations; the relationships between motor vehicle accidents and land use, population, employment, and economic activity; an in-vehicle data recorder to monitor and analyze driver behavior; a procedure for ranking the safety of intersections according to red-light crash frequency; factors that affect the severity of head-on crashes; and the effects of daylight savings time on the number of motor vehicle crashes that result in injury.
Individual TRR Journals, which are published on an irregular basis throughout the year, consist of collections of peer-reviewed papers on specific transportation subject areas and modes. Abstracts of papers that make up this TRR are available through TRB's Publication Index.
TRR Journals may also be purchased on an annual subscription basis. Each year, TRB publishes approximately 45 volumes of the TRR Journal, containing more than 800 papers grouped by subject.
